Early preparation sets the tone for a smooth move. Start by deciding on your move-out date and giving your landlord proper notice if you’re renting.
Research moving companies in BC and get multiple quotes

Create a digital or printed checklist for tasks and deadlines
Gather important documents (leases, mortgage info, insurance) in one folder
Early planning helps you compare prices and lock in availability - especially during BC’s busy moving months from May to September.

This is the best time to downsize. Moving unnecessary items adds to both stress and cost.
Donate, sell, or recycle items you no longer need
Organize belongings by room and label fragile items
Start collecting free boxes from grocery stores or community groups
Buy essentials like packing tape, bubble wrap, and markers
Decluttering now reduces what you’ll need to pack later and makes unpacking faster in your new home.

At the one-month mark, it’s time to secure your moving team and start packing the items you use least.

Update your address with Canada Post, banks, insurance, and utilities
Pack non-essentials like books, off-season clothes, and decor
Clearly label each box with the contents and destination room
Having a clear labeling system saves time and avoids confusion for both you and your movers.
Now is the time to finalize logistics and pack almost everything except your daily essentials.
Pack most belongings, leaving only what you need for the final week
Prepare a “first-night box” with toiletries, chargers, snacks, and clothes
Arrange for pet or child care if necessary
Confirm elevator reservations or loading access with your building management
Double-check parking access at your new home

The countdown is on - now it’s time to handle last-minute details and ensure nothing gets overlooked.
Disassemble large furniture where possible
Clean each room as it’s packed
Dispose of hazardous materials like paint or propane safely
Confirm your mover’s arrival time and contact details
Prepare tarps or covers for rain protection
Also, confirm key handovers and do a quick walkthrough of your old home to ensure nothing is left behind.

Once the boxes are inside, it’s time to unpack and make your new house feel like home.
Unpack essentials first - kitchen, bathroom, and bedroom
Set up Wi-Fi and confirm all utilities are running
Update your driver’s license, BC Health Card, and other official documents
Register for city services, including garbage collection and recreation passes
Explore your new neighborhood and meet your neighbors
